CLIENTS WE SUPPORT
Grace Moore House provides housing solutions for individuals referred by social workers, including:
-
Seniors seeking stable housing
-
Veterans transitioning to community living
-
Individuals needing affordable housing
-
Residents looking for safe and independent living environments
-
Individuals in recovery from substance abuse
REFERRAL PROCESS:
01
Submit a referral or inquiry
02
Provide basic client information
03
Our team reviews eligibility and housing availability
04
Placement coordination and move-in support
Our team works closely with social workers to ensure the process is clear and efficient.
